We are seeking an Employee Onboarding Specialist to manage the end-to-end onboarding experience for new hires across our organization. This is a meaningful opportunity to help shape and mature the onboarding and offboarding functions within the Talent Acquisition team by actively improving the systems, processes, and touchpoints that define how people experience joining our company. In this role, you will exercise independent judgment to manage competing priorities, navigate ambiguous situations, and serve as a trusted resource for new hires, hiring managers, and HR partners alike. As one of the first people a new employee interacts with, you will play a direct and lasting role in shaping their impression of our culture.

This is a hybrid role with a 50% on-site requirement in Wilmington, MA

  • Take ownership of tracking new hire’s pre-boarding process, ensuring all required documentation including Form I-9, background screenings, payroll forms, and personal identification, is completed accurately and on time
  • Proactively identify and resolve gaps in new hire task completion, using discretion to determine the appropriate escalation path when issues arise
  • Act as a strategic liaison between new hires, hiring managers, and HR functions, including Talent Acquisition, Payroll, Employee Relations, Benefits, and Compliance, exercising judgment to triage issues and connecting the right parties
  • Communicate with regional location management, providing timely status updates and proactively surfacing risks or delays before they escalate
  • Manage the onboarding email inbox, responding with professionalism and appropriate urgency, and identifying patterns that signal process gaps
  • Coordinate and lead orientation for Wilmington, MA new hires
  • Design and deliver intentional pre-boarding touchpoints that foster a sense of belonging and reflect our company culture from day one 
  • Develop and maintain onboarding materials, resources, and training content
  • Analyze onboarding survey data to identify trends and translate insights into actionable recommendations for process improvement
  • Build and own reports and presentations that measure pre-boarding efficiency, track key metrics, and communicate areas of opportunity to stakeholders
  • Take initiative in identifying and leading improvements to onboarding workflows going beyond day-to-day execution to continuously raise the bar on the new hire experience
  • Complete additional onboarding related tasks as assigned

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ree with a concentration in Business, Human Resources, Organizational Development, or related field required
  • 2-3 years’ experience in human resources, onboarding, employee relations, or professional communications or a combination of work and education experience
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ail
  • Ability to quickly learn new software Ability to prioritize responsibilities and lead proactively
  • With support and guidance, take ownership of projects and see them through to completion
  • Comfortable speaking with people using various channels of communication including phone, video conference, texting, emailing, etc.
  • Knowledge of federal, state, and local employment regulations to ensure compliant pre-employment documentation (I-9, W-4) is a strong plus
